This report studies the Volatile Corrosion Inhibitors (VCI) Packaging Material market. Volatile corrosion inhibitors (VCI) packaging material is usually paper or plastic, which has been impregnated with corrosion inhibitors. It can provide optimum protection of metal parts, parts, components, castings and assemblies from corrosion.
The global market for Volatile Corrosion Inhibitors (VCI) Packaging Material was estimated to be worth US$ 643 million in 2023 and is forecast to a readjusted size of US$ 896.2 million by 2030 with a CAGR of 4.8% during the forecast period 2024-2030
Global volatile corrosion inhibitors (VCI) packaging material key players include CORTEC, Aicello, etc. Global top 2 manufacturers hold a share about 30%.
North America is the largest market, with a share over 25%, followed by Europe and China, both have a share about 40 percent.
In terms of product, VCI paper is the largest segment, with a share over 40%. And in terms of application, the largest application is metallurgy industry, followed by aerospace industry, automotive industry, oil, gas and process industries, electronics industry, etc.
